Armenia - Export of Waste or Scrap of Precious Metals Except Pure Gold and Platinum
Since 2014, Armenia Export of Waste or Scrap of Precious Metals Except Pure Gold and Platinum increased 85.2% year on year. In 2019, the country was ranked number 17 among other countries in Export of Waste or Scrap of Precious Metals Except Pure Gold and Platinum with $81,480,840. Armenia is overtaken by Japan, which was ranked number 16 with $82,220,736 and is followed by Netherlands at $80,934,930.78. United States topped the ranking with $2,534,500,446.7 in 2019, -7.2% compared to 2018. Indonesia, Canada and United Kingdom resp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Kyrgyzstan witnessed the best average annual growth at +199.3% per year, while El Salvador was the worst growing country at -70.8% per year.
